Orthodontists are accredited dental practitioners who concentrate on the art of appropriately aligning teeth for much better dental health, far better general wellness, more reliable and comfortable bite, and higher smile self-confidence. Each patients' situation is unique, so orthodontists need to have a wide knowledge and experience in a large selection of treatment methods and home appliances.


In addition to functioning with people, orthodontists are frequently in charge of leading a group of oral experts, which needs directing and managing oral aides and hygienists, and dealing with workplace supervisors to maintain the workplace running efficiently. Those orthodontists who enter into personal method will additionally be accountable for the many aspects of small company possession, including paying tax obligations and office rental costs, tracking spending plans, working with, managing, and discipling team, and a lot more.


That's because all orthodontists are, in fact, dental professionals: they complete oral institution and ending up being certified dentists prior to taking place to specialize via a residency program. Oral school is usually 4 years: candidates need to have completed undergraduate education and learning and take the Oral Assessment Examination (DAT). The test is racked up on a range from 1-30, with the average rating being 17.

The job atmosphere is busy and busy: many orthodontist deal with other oral specialists, serving numerous individuals at once in various areas of the workplace. All orthodontist workplaces are called for to abide by state and government health and wellness policies, to shield personnel and people in a medical setup. There are a variety of expert alternatives for orthodontists: As a member of an orthodontic team, you will certainly have your very own caseload of clients yet job under an overseeing orthodontist or professional director.


Lots of orthodontists begin out as part of a group method, yet go on to start their own organization or partner with 1 or 2 other orthodontists. This makes them both exercising orthodontists and local business owners, employing a small team of oral aides, hygienists, and/or workplace administrators to assist them see and handle people.


Technique ownership also needs looking after rigorous conformity with state and government policies for patient and team wellness and safety, medical privacy, labor methods, and a lot more. The bulk of practitioners take on debt in order to open an office, so there are large financial risks involved. Starting your own orthodontic practice is economically dangerous and a requiring life path, however an effective individual method can produce much greater salaries and job adaptability, especially if your technique increases by working with more orthodontists.
